Output dd0631c9f6588fb69273e20c6df585883469d5a7edc2d38b406252e7cd3b401d:12

value
682000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c79e01ad0936a6fb2e80d2dae375433fd834b0 OP_EQUAL
address
34mdMXBpK17M8cN393HX4bgRfLKGfH18Cz
transaction
dd0631c9f6588fb69273e20c6df585883469d5a7edc2d38b406252e7cd3b401d